Rigorous design of autonomous systems for the Internet of Things (IoT)

  • 講者Panagiotis Katsaros 教授 (School of Informatics, Aristotle University of Thessaloniki, Greece)
    邀請人:陳郁方
  • 時間2019-09-24 (Tue.) 10:00 ~ 12:00
  • 地點資訊所新館101演講廳
摘要

AI-based autonomy is increasingly used for the automation of functions in smart systems (e.g. smart grids, smart transport systems), where various computational entities (edge/fog nodes, servers, clouds, applications and services) are tightly interacting with physical components through sensors and actuators. Such systems can accomplish tasks independently, or with minimal supervision from humans and can optimise the management of resources, in complex and unpredictable environments. Let us consider the case of sensor devices situated in heterogeneous environments that change over time e.g. due to sensors mobility or changes in the weather conditions. Instead of looking at these devices as energy-constrained sources of data, to avoid both over-dimensioning them with larger than necessary energy sources and risking with less frequent than necessary sensing (in order to save energy), we see them as autonomous agents with adaptive sensing capabilities.In this seminar, I will first present my current research work on the rigorous model-based design of IoT systems. This is only the first step towards our vision for the rigorous design of smart autonomous systems that will be trustworthy enough for their intended use. Serious concerns remain about the trustworthiness and safety of current machine learning technologies, whereas formal model-based design approaches are generally applicable only to non-learning systems that operate in well-characterised environments. We aim to

• combine the best of model-based design with formal guarantees

• leverage the advances of machine learning and

• introduce novel machine learning and synthesis techniques, developed specifically for system design.
